What are the Challenges in Nanoparticle Catalysis?
Despite their advantages, nanoparticle catalysts face several challenges:
Stability: Nanoparticles can agglomerate, losing their high surface area and catalytic activity. Scalability: Producing nanoparticles on a large scale while maintaining their quality is difficult. Reusability: Ensuring that nanoparticles can be easily recovered and reused without significant loss of activity. Environmental Impact: The synthesis and disposal of nanoparticles can have environmental ramifications.
